Specimen notes
Public Note:
Standing dead tree. Cap 2.5-4cm olivaceous to olivaceous grey. Cortina glutinous. Gills distant. Stem 0.8x8cm straw at apex deepening to bay at base, fasciculate. Taste indistinct. Smell sweet when cut (like suillus).
